Web22 de sept. de 2024 · An action to enforce an Indiana mechanics lien must be initiated within 1 year of the date the lien was received for recording. However, Indiana's lien enforcement deadline can be shortened to 30 days if the property owner properly sends a 30-day Notice to Foreclose to the lien claimant. This notice states that the failure to file … A judgment lien is created automatically on the debtor's property if the property is located in the Indiana county where the judgment is handed down. For debtor property in another Indiana county, the creditor files a copy of the judgment with the circuit court clerk for that county. Web5 de ago. de 2016 · By statute, a personal judgment does not become a judgment lien on real estate until “the judgment is recorded in the docket in the county where the realty held by the debtor is located.” Indiana’s judgment lien statute at Ind. Code 34-55-9-2 makes judgments a lien “after the judgment is entered and indexed.” WebUnder Indiana law, if you reinstate before the court enters judgment, the foreclosure will be dismissed.
